Faizan Zaki's historic Scripps National Spelling Bee victory

In a display of linguistic prowess and unwavering determination, 13-year-old Faizan Zaki from Allen, Texas, has been crowned the 2025 Scripps National Spelling Bee champion, marking the centennial of the prestigious competition.
Zaki's journey to the top was a testament to perseverance, as he clinched the win after a heartbreaking runner-up finish in last year's competition.
He is notably only the fifth speller in the Bee's history to win the championship after placing second the previous year. His winning word, "éclaircissement" – a French-derived term meaning "the clearing up of something obscure: enlightenment" – was delivered with remarkable composure, despite a momentary lapse in an earlier round that nearly cost him the title.
Adam Symson, president and CEO of The E.W. Scripps Company, presented the trophy to Zaki, commending his focus and determination throughout the rigorous competition.
This year's 97th Scripps National Spelling Bee took place in National Harbor, Maryland, with 242 spellers from across the nation competing for the coveted title.

After correctly spelling "éclaircissement," Zaki’s joy was evident as he collapsed to the stage amidst falling confetti, a moment of pure elation marking the culmination of years of rigorous training and dedication.
He takes home the Scripps Cup, a $50,000 cash prize from Scripps, a $2,500 cash prize and reference library from Merriam-Webster, and reference works from Encyclopædia Britannica. Additionally, his school will receive Scholastic Dollars and a News-O-Matic subscription. Sarvadnya Kadam placed second, receiving $25,000, and Sarv Dharavane placed third, receiving $15,000.
